Title :
Modified double-modulation signal PWM control for D-STATCOM using Five-Level Double Converter
Author :
Kimura, Noriyuki ; Morizane, Toshimitsu ; Taniguchi, Katsunori ; Nishida, Yasuyuki
Author_Institution :
Osaka Inst. of Technol., Osaka
Abstract :
This paper suggests the new modulation method of the multi-level double converter system used for static synchronous compensator for distribution power system (D-STATCOM). The proposed modulation method can change the modulation factor for each level of the converter to control the balance of each dc capacitor voltage and also can reduce the higher harmonics and the switching loss.
